After switching to the Aliyun server, besides setting up the blog, I also took the opportunity to set up my own mail server. I used the iRedMail suite, which bundles and installs the whole package, including smtp, pop3, imap, SSL encryption, and webmail, making it quite convenient. Given Gmail’s increasingly difficult situation in China, but since I don’t want to switch to some domestic website’s email service, using a mail service I run myself may be a good choice. Of course Gmail has its irreplaceable advantage—search—so my own mailbox will not replace Gmail for the time being; it will only serve as an auxiliary tool to some extent.
